Rev. Kathryn KelloggRev. Kathryn Kellogg serves as the Children’s and Family Ministry Coordinator at the Association of Unity Churches International home office. For 25 years, Rev. Kathryn has served Unity families as a youth and family ministry director, a regional education consultant for the Southwest Unity region, and an ordained Unity minister specializing in youth and family ministry. With a degree in music education from Wichita State University, she taught for seven years in the public schools before following her passion for children’s spiritual education.

Actively involved in children’s and teen ministry since high school, Rev. Kathryn has worked to create ministry for young people that is age-appropriate and which recognizes them as whole spiritual beings. Her passion is to create safe, loving environments where children and teens can explore their relationship with God and where each individual journey to self awareness/God-awareness is honored. Her vision is that each child knows that they are loved and supported by a community of faith that holds them precious and irreplaceable, and to be aware that they have the power to co-create with God an amazing life.

Currently, Rev. Kathryn oversees credentialing programs in Unity youth and family ministry including the Certified Spiritual Educators Program and the Licensed Unity Teachers Specializing in Youth and Family Ministry. Consulting with churches, she helps with questions about sacred safety, curriculum choices, resources, staffing, training and more. As editor of Education Links, Rev. Kathryn is always looking for ways to educate, expand and deepen Unity’s commitment to excellence in children’s and family
ministry.

Rev. Mark FiskRev. Mark Fisk is a Youth pastor and Spiritual Coach who has served Unity churches for over 15 years. Based in Phoenix with his loving wife, Rhonda, Rev. Mark is a former Wall Street Investment banker. He left his career to backpack around the world, and shortly afterward began pursuing his passion of spiritual education. Rev. Mark is currently the Association of Unity Churches’ Southwest Region Teen Minister. In this role he not only helps churches design Family Ministry programs but also coordi-nates teen regional etreats, workshops, and leadership programs. He also serves as an Adjunct Minister at Unity of Phoenix.

Clare RhoadsClare Rhoads, M.C. received her Master of Counseling degree from Arizona State University. She has a Graduate Diploma of Business Administration from a top European business school and is taking doctoral level psychology classes at ASU. She has been a Rotary Good Will Ambassador to India and England, and an American Field Service Good Will Ambassador to Japan. Her primary areas of expertise are in anger management, conflict resolution, divorce/ step-family issues, self-esteem and resiliency. Working with teens and their families is her passion. Her workshops meet the specific requirements of prevention programs for the Juvenile Justice System and school system.
